摘要
Indole-3-acetic acid (IAA) produced by intestinal bacteria from tryptophan in dietary proteins is considered to suppress the inflammatory response through aryl hydrocarbon receptor (AhR) activation. However, AhR activation was not involved in the downregulation of tumor necrosis factor alpha (TNF alpha) expression induced by IAA in Caco-2 cells. The activation of unidentified IAA receptors might attenuate the inflammatory response to TNF alpha in colorectal cancer cells.
